Or, on the other side of the table:

His HR totals are up. Aside from that, he hasn’t really been better than the last couple of seasons pre-2018. Both major analytics sites have his overall defense as even or negative. 

I’m skeptical he gets anyone willing to pay $14 mil for him next season considering it’s his age 32 season. His HR total is likely a fluke, and his defense may be trending down if BR and FG are correct.

If there is a taker in the offseason, I think you take what you can get. More likely, his option is simply not picked up. And honestly, I doubt they bring him back on the cheap.

At least keep him this season, then exercise the option, and if there is a pitcher out there on a team needing an experienced and solid RF, then they could trade him and if necessary send enough of the 2020 salary with him.

I think this is a fair plan. If the Angels wind up not signing Gerrit Cole, they could still have the money needed for another SP, and Kole could give them some offensive cushion or trade piece for a similarly valued vet SP. Also, open to the idea of a restructured deal for 2020 if it cut his salary down some, and he was open to a role where he potentially lost RF to Adell, covering 1B/4th OF instead. 

Julio Teheran could be that arm. He has a $12m option for ‘20. The Braves have Markakis as a RF option next year, but he’s also on a team option.

Teheran’s had another solid, durable year. Markakis as well, but he’s taken a bit of a step back.

The Angels could even go with a winter swap of Calhoun and Bedrosian for Teheran and Markakis and I’d argue it’d help both teams out. Markakis can transition more to the role Bour filled, with the ability to cover RF if Adell struggles, or RF/LF if anyone gets hurt. Braves would get a hometown relief arm they need, and a more dynamic RF to upgrade over Markakis. Opens up a rotation slot for Bumgarner (who they will sign) or one of their many SP prospects. The money evens out fairly. The Angels would get a solid arm for ‘20.
